BN 52115 is a platelet activating factor antagonist that has been found to inhibit in vivo bronchopulmonary alteration.

Name: BN 52115

CAS#: 120908-94-3

Chemical Formula: C37H60BrNO4

Exact Mass: 661.3706

Molecular Weight: 662.79

Elemental Analysis: C, 67.05; H, 9.13; Br, 12.06; N, 2.11; O, 9.66
